Disarming the Church

For 400 years (until Augustine), the Church believed that, when Jesus told Peter to put down his weapon on the night of his arrest, he disarmed all Christians for all time.

There is nothing Christian about owning a gun, using violence to defend oneself betrays our lack of faith in the One who will one day raise all the dead.
